Keel-billed Toucans occur naturally in southern Mexico (where they are the only large, naturally occurring toucans), south through most of Central America (Guatemala, Belize, Honduras, Nicaragua, Costa Rica and Panama) to the northern parts of South America (northern Colombia and extreme. The species is found in tropical jungles from southern Mexico to Colombia. Its diet is based mostly on the fruit and berries.
The bill is brightly colored, light-weight, and edged with toothed margins.
